Responsibilities

  • Design scalable pipelines to collect, process, and analyze high-volume sensor data.
  • Model physical relationships governing complex manufacturing processes.
  • Develop predictive and control algorithms using physics-based and machine learning methods.
  • Create ML surrogates and reduced-order models based on rigorous physics simulations.
  • Build maintainable software modules for manufacturing tools, control systems, dashboards, and intelligent automation applications.
  • Analyze sensor and metrology data and iteratively improve simulation and model accuracy and performance.
  • Collaborate with physics, engineering, software, and data science teams to deploy solutions.

About Applied Materials

10,000+ employees

Applied Materials builds semiconductor and display manufacturing equipment and related materials engineering technologies used by chip and flat-panel makers. It sells capital tools, process technology, and lifecycle services and software to support high-volume wafer fabrication and display production worldwide. Founded in 1967 and headquartered in Santa Clara, California, the company is publicly traded on NASDAQ under the ticker AMAT.
